pushback
- IPA[ˈpo͝oSHˌbak]
美式
- a negative or unfavorable reaction or response;(at an airport) the process of moving an aircraft from a passenger terminal to a runway or taxiway
noun: pushback
- 釋義
名詞
- 1. a negative or unfavorable reaction or response we got some pushback on the new pricing
- 2. (at an airport) the process of moving an aircraft from a passenger terminal to a runway or taxiway rules about having all passengers seated before pushback from the gate are not always followed they held the plane an extra 13 minutes past its scheduled pushback
